Cascadero Copper (CVE:CCD) Stock Price Up 25% – Here’s Why

Cascadero Copper Co. (CVE:CCDGet Free Report)’s share price shot up 25% on Monday . The stock traded as high as C$0.03 and last traded at C$0.03. 328,500 shares were traded during trading, an increase of 121% from the average session volume of 148,886 shares. The stock had previously closed at C$0.02.

Cascadero Copper Price Performance

The stock has a market cap of C$7.50 million, a PE ratio of -25.00 and a beta of -6.52. The business has a fifty day simple moving average of C$0.01 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of C$0.01. The company has a current ratio of 0.54, a quick ratio of 3.44 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 21.60.

Cascadero Copper Corporation, an exploration stage company, engages in the acquisition, exploration, and development of mineral properties primarily in Argentina. The company explores for cesium, silver, zinc, lead, gold, uranium, copper, tellurium, tin, molybdenum, iron, and rubidium ores. It holds interests in 27 mineral properties located in the northern area of the Argentine Puna. Cascadero Copper Corporation was incorporated in 2003 and is headquartered in North Vancouver, Canada.
